Q: How do I get into the shared lab we use with the Orvane Systems team?

A: The lab on level 3 of Penhallow House is jointly managed. Standard staff badges do not open it; access is via the keypad by the double doors. Orvane visitors must be escorted at all times. Facilities desk staff should use the code below.

staff pass of kawip-hawef = bdg-QLP-2

Small note for anyone new to the Examward queue code: the proctor-assignment worker polls rather than subscribing, which is intentional — it keeps backpressure predictable during exam-start spikes. Please don't change the poll cadence without checking load tests first. If a session waits too long it escalates automatically. The relevant constants are defined directly below.

tuning table, yajog-yahof:
BUDGETS = {
    "lamvan": 303,
    "wenox": 460,
    "fenvan": 525,
}

### Changelog — Tracewell v2.9.0 (setting renamed)

The variable formerly called SPANLINK_COLLECTOR_TOKEN_OLD has been renamed to clarify that it authorizes cross-service trace export, not local span buffering. Services on the Harrowfield cluster must update their env files before the Thursday rollout; the old name is now ignored silently, which means traces will simply stop stitching across microservice boundaries with no error logged. After removing the deprecated entry, add the renamed setting on its own line as follows.

sealed setting: ARCHIVE_KEY3=8d0